Limited DVD & CD version

Live concert from the Cricket Pavilion, Phoenix, Arizona, 22nd June 2007.

Track Listing

Disc 1 - DVD

  1. Thriller
  2. Grand Theft Autumn / Where Is Your Boy (Gabe From Cobra Starship)
  3. Don’t Matter (Akon Cover)
  4. Sugar, We’re Going Down
  5. Our Lawyer Made Us Change The Name Of This Song So We Wouldn’t Get Sued
  6. Of All The Gin Joints In The World
  7. Hum Hallelujah
  8. I Slept With Someone In Fall Out Boy And All I Got Was This Stupid Song Written About Me
  9. Tell That Mick He Just Made My List Of Things To Do Today
  10. I’m Like A Lawyer The Way I’m Always Trying To Get You Off (Me & You)
  11. Little Less Sixteen Candles, A Little More 'Touch Me'
  12. Beat It (Michael Jackson Cover)
  13. Carpal Of Love
  14. Golden
  15. I Write Sins, Not Tragedies (Panic! @ The Disco Cover)
  16. This Ain’t A Scene, It’s An Arms Race
  17. Thnks Fr Th Mmrs
  18. The Take Over, The Breaks Over
  19. One And Only (Timbaland Cover)
  20. Dance, Dance
  21. Drum Solo
  22. Saturday
  23. Sugar, We’re Going Down (Video)
  24. Dance, Dance (Video)
  25. A Little Less Sixteen Candles, A Little More 'Touch Me' (Video)
  26. This Aint a Scene, It's an Arms Race (Video)
  27. Thnks fr mmrs (Video)
  28. Carpal Tunnel Of Love (Video)
  29. The Take Over, The Break's Over (Video)
  30. Me & you (Video)
  31. Behind the scenes Documentary (Approx 45 mins)

Disc 2 - CD

  1. studio recording of the new single ‘Beat It’, 2 teaser tracks from the live album, and 3 exclusive tracks

The objectives of German experimental rock and electronic music in the 1970s were to create a new music, 'free' from the past. Music for a generation who grew up stifled by the recent history of Nazi atrocities and the guilt of their parents' generation. The first seeds were planted in 1968, as students and workers in Paris, Prague, Mexico and around the world demonstrated against mainstream society, the war in Vietnam, imperialism and bourgeois values.
